BEN has a special status at the Blue Cross home in Kimpton.

He is the longest stay dog at the shelter for animals but if a new owner can be found he could be in a home of his own by Christmas.

Ben, who has been in the care of pet charity Blue Cross since May 26, is a neutered Lab cross aged about eight.

He is intelligent and would like a home with someone who is familiar with the fine qualities of Labradors which are adaptable and devoted.

Ben loves playing with a ball and is good to walk on the lead. He does, however, like to chase cats and other small animals so he is looking for a home as an only pet.

Ben knows how to sit, give paw and lay down. He enjoys learning new things.
